2010-01-28 8 views
10

Windows Task Manager répertorie tous les processus en cours d'exécution dans l'onglet "Processus". Le nom d'image des scripts Python est toujours python.exe ou pythonw.exe ou le nom de l'interpréteur Python.Modification du nom du processus du script Python

Existe-t-il un moyen agréable de changer le nom de l'image d'un script Python, autre que de changer le nom de l'interpréteur Python?

+0

Je ne pense pas qu'il y ait un moyen sensé de faire cela. Je dirais que c'est un bug dans taskman qu'il ne donne pas l'option plutôt évidente d'afficher les titres de fenêtre où ils sont disponibles au lieu de noms de processus. –

Répondre

1

Il n'y a aucun moyen agréable que j'ai trouvé de changer le nom d'un processus en cours d'exécution sous Windows, mais vous pouvez créer de petits talons .exe avec ExeMaker plutôt que de recourir à py2exe emballage ou la copie de l'interprète

L'exe stub utilise son propre nom de module pour calculer le script .py invoqué. Vous devriez être capable d'utiliser un éditeur de ressources exe pour changer l'icône.

1

Vous pouvez utiliser py2exe pour transformer votre programme Python en un exécutable autonome avec le nom que vous choisissez de lui donner.

+0

C'est juste un hack terrible. –

+2

Pourquoi utilise py2exe un hack? –

Questions connexes